| Brand | EVGA |
|---|---|
| Model | 256-A8-N542-TX |
| Interface | AGP 4X/8X |
|---|
| Chipset Manufacturer | NVIDIA |
|---|---|
| GPU | GeForce 7600GS |
| Core Clock | 400 MHz |
| PixelPipelines | 12 |
| Effective Memory Clock | 800 MHz |
|---|---|
| Memory Size | 256MB |
| Memory Interface | 128-Bit |
| Memory Type | GDDR2 |
| DirectX | DirectX 9 |
|---|---|
| OpenGL | OpenGL 2.0 |
| D-SUB | 1 x D-SUB |
|---|---|
| DVI | 1 x DVI |
| TV-Out | HDTV / S-Video / Composite Out |
| Tuner | None |
|---|---|
| RAMDAC | 400MHz |
| Max Resolution | 2560 x 1600 |
| Cooler | Single Fan |
| Operating Systems Supported | Windows XP/XP x64/MCE 2005 |
| System Requirements | Minimum of a 350 Watt power supply. (Minimum recommended power supply with +12 Volt current rating of 18 Amps.) An available 4-pin Molex hard drive power dongle |
| Dual-Link DVI Supported | Yes |
| Package Contents | 256-A8-N542-TX Driver Disk HDTV Cable S-Video Cable Power Cable DVI to VGA/D-sub Adapte |
